As of October 3, 2013 the realms of Faerun in the Neverwinter MMO have been seeing a fair barrage of announcements concerning; new weekly sales, their latest lockbox, a new Call to Arms event, and probably most exciting of all, for many of the players, further news of their promised server merge. With so many announcements, the official website found here, makes for the best means of covering them all. While each individual news announcement will be linked below following their details.

First of all the pending server merge; while many MMO's and their communities have viewed server merges as a symptom attributed to a failure of the game involved, the shattered realms of Faerun simply cannot. The reality of the story making up the lore of the game itself cannot help but recognize how differently this announcement would be received. For those familiar with the lore, this merge is akin to a restoration of the realms shattered by the spell plague. While for others it may be exciting simply to know that their friends that may have joined the game from different servers will now be able to play alongside one another without the duress of starting up a whole new character. Those that have been playing since the onset of this game, even in beta; knew already that this has been an intended goal of the developers all along. A new Call to Arms event, further enforces the excitement of friends being joined together soon. The previous Call to Arms was their first event of this kind. As of today October 3, 2013 a second call to arms has been made. Helm's hold has issued this call rewarding a Helmite Ghost Paladin companion to those lucky enough to be awarded such; a spirit akin to those which swore their oaths to the guardian god to protect the world from evil. While this is certainly not the only reward this call provides, it is certain to create a driving force behind the Helm's Hold Call to Arms while this event is active. As the feywild lockboxes make their exit, the Dark Forest lockbox creates a new incentive to invest in the purchase of Enchanted Keys from their money market. Players that may not have found the feywild lockbox enticements tempting enough, may now find themselves tempted with top rewards this box has to offer. An Owlbear mount, once a fierce predator of the Feywild now tamed as a mount for lucky adventures to gambit a chance at owning or the Pseudodragon companion, a venom tipped tail and bite made worse by that very poisonous assault will both soon be seen about the Protector's Enclave as those lucky enough to find them in these lockboxes make their presence known. Last but definitely not the least of these latest announcements from the Neverwinter MMO, are the latest addition of weekly sale items. As of last week, the Neverwinter money-market has begun rotating price reductions on select items that will change on a weekly basis.
